Formal conferences are a common part of the business community. They allow the discussion and exchange of ideas amongst the members of a company or organisation, which can be vital in building a healthy and productive environment.

The purpose of a formal meeting is always to discuss or perhaps plan some thing, usually in a set time frame. It’s important to contain boardrooms plans prepared ahead of time and move this to participants. It is also a good idea to explain voting items and evidently outline how decisions will be made.

A good intention for a formal meeting carries a discussion on old business and loose ends, an open discussion of new company plans, any major press releases that have occurred and action items through the last reaching. This allows the members to keep track of what has been carried out and is necessary in keeping everyone about particular date with adjustments that are occurring within the organisation.

Often , an official meeting is certainly held in a meeting room or other appropriate space. You have to ensure that this is the right setting for the meeting, as it could affect it is mood and ambiance.

Typical meetings, one the other side of the coin side, are a little not as much structured than formal kinds and are more relaxed in nature. They may be held in a number of settings, from your workplace to a regional coffee shop or perhaps remotely.

In informal group meetings, there are a reduced amount of conventions as well as the attendees generally determine what will probably be discussed. Nevertheless , it’s nonetheless a good idea to designate someone who will need notes and stay on issue.
